Mosquitoes are breeding in your backyard—yes, even in tiny puddles from plant saucers or water butts. These pests thrive in stagnant water, needing just a few days to lay eggs and hatch. The fix? Empty water sources every 3-4 days—or cover them with mesh to block egg-laying. And don’t forget flyscreens on doors and windows to keep them out of your home. Simple steps, big impact.
